Slate roof construction services involve the installation of durable, natural slate tiles to create a classic and long-lasting roofing system. These services typically include the careful assessment of the roof structure, precise measurement and cutting of slate pieces, and the meticulous fitting of each tile to ensure a secure and weather-resistant surface. Skilled contractors may also handle the preparation of the roof deck, installation of necessary underlayments, and the finishing details such as flashing and ridge caps to ensure a seamless and aesthetically appealing roof. The process emphasizes craftsmanship and attention to detail to preserve the natural beauty and integrity of the slate material.

One of the key problems slate roof construction helps address is the need for a resilient roofing solution that can withstand harsh we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and wind. Slate roofs are known for their longevity and resistance to decay, making them a practical choice for homeowners seeking a low-maintenance and durable roof. Additionally, proper slate installation can prevent issues such as leaks, water infiltration, and structural damage caused by poorly fitted or aging roofing materials. Experienced contractors also ensure that the roof’s ventilation and drainage are correctly integrated, reducing the risk of moisture buildup and related problems over time.

Professionals specializing in slate roof construction bring expertise in handling the unique characteristics of natural slate, which can be heavier and more fragile than other roofing materials. They are equipped to address challenges such as slate breakage during installation and ensure that the roof structure can support the weight of the tiles. These services often include repairs or replacements of damaged slate sections, as well as the installation of new roofs on properties that value the timeless look and resilience of slate. What are the benefits of slate roof construction?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ural appearance,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for lasting roofing solutions.

How long does a slate roof typ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, slate roofs can last 75 years or more, often outlasting other roofing materials.

What should I consider when choosing slate roofing contractors? It's important to select experienced local pros who specialize in slate roof installation and repair to ensure quality workmanship.

Can slate roofs be repaired if damaged? Yes, damaged slate tiles can often be replaced or repaired by qualified service providers to maintain the roof's integrity.

Are there different types of slate used in roofing? Yes, various types of natural slate exist, each with unique colors and qualities, which local pros can help select for your project.
